Canucks goaltender Thatcher Demko was solid between the pipes Monday, stopping 28 of 30 shots faced in the Canucks' 6-2 win over the Stars.
Fantasy Impact
Demko picked up his fifth consecutive win Monday night for the Canucks, posting a 2.00 goals against average and .943 save percentage in that span. The netminder has kept Vancouver in the postseason hunt, posting a .918 save percentage and 2.63 goals against average with one shutout in 61 games this season (33-20-6).

Thatcher Demko stopped 30 of 34 shots in a 4-3 overtime loss to the Capitals. The four goals against were split, two on the power play and two at even strength.
Fantasy Impact
Demko falls to 26-16-3 this season with a 2.67 GAA and a .916 save percentage. The overtime loss breaks a three game winning streak. He still remains a solid starting option.
